In the present clinical trial dentists were asked to talk to patients about the subject of "Prevention". A patient-dentist conversation was to be conducted in two different time frames. In the first group the dentist took as much time as seemed necessary for communicating with the patient. In the second group the restricting condition was that approximately an average number of patients had appointments under office conditions. The results demonstrate that under controlled conditions dentists show a communicative behavior which will focus the patients attention on compliant oral hygiene. However, under the pressure of limited time, this behavior will no longer be sufficient to achieve optimum patient compliance through such a talk alone.
